Ballon framing was a popular method of construction for wood buildings before it was supplanted by platform framing. Platform framing involves building a single-story wall and then constructing the next floor on top of the wall studs. This method creates fire stopping, which helps minimize the spread of fire. This technique is an example of fire compartmentation.
